Alfonso Reyes was a Mexican writer, philosopher, and diplomat who is considered one of the most important figures in Latin American literature. His work is characterized by its breadth and depth, and it encompasses a wide range of genres, including poetry, fiction, essays, and criticism.

The Complete Works of Alfonso Reyes is a monumental undertaking that brings together all of Reyes's published writings in a single, comprehensive edition. This first volume of the series contains Reyes's early poetry, which is marked by its formal experimentation and its exploration of themes such as love, death, and the nature of reality.
